Mumbai Indians (Mumbai Indians) have landed in serious trouble early in IPL 2026. With just 1 win in 5 matches and a brutal Net Run Rate of -1.076, Hardik Pandya’s side is already under heavy pressure.
Are MI already out?
No. But they are walking a tightrope now.
The harsh reality
- Matches played: 5
- Wins: 1
- Points: 2
- Position: Bottom-half struggle
- Remaining matches: 9
To reach the safe zone (around 16 points), MI now need something close to a miracle comeback — at least 7 wins out of 9.
Even if they manage 14 points (6 wins), qualification will NOT be guaranteed. It will depend on:
- Other teams collapsing
- Massive Net Run Rate recovery
The biggest problem: NRR nightmare
That -1.076 NRR is a silent killer. It means MI don’t just need wins — they need dominating wins. Close victories won’t be enough anymore.
